AI Technical Summary
Existing technologies lack structures capable of continuous dehydration, solidification, and discharge, making it impossible to continuously add sludge for dehydration, thus affecting sludge treatment efficiency and effectiveness.
A sludge dewatering and solidification treatment device was designed, comprising a filter press and discharge mechanism and a feeding mechanism. The filter press cylinder squeezes the sludge to squeeze out water through protrusions and moves the sludge forward through a scraper. The discharge mechanism controls the discharge of sludge through an elastic cover plate. The feeding mechanism controls the continuous addition of sludge through a baffle plate and a gear system.
It enables continuous dewatering and discharge of sludge, improves treatment efficiency, and allows control over the amount of sludge added, ensuring the continuity of treatment results.

Technical Field
[0001] This invention relates to the field of sludge treatment technology, and more specifically, to a sludge dewatering and solidification treatment apparatus and method. Background Technology
[0002] Wastewater treatment processes generate large amounts of sludge with extremely high water content. Sludge treatment typically involves a combination of concentration and dewatering. Even after concentration, the water content remains very high, requiring further dewatering to reduce it. Common dewatering methods include natural drying and mechanical dewatering, as well as electroosmosis.
[0003] However, traditional sludge dewatering and solidification treatment involves squeezing sludge through multiple filter plates. Existing technologies lack a structure that can continuously dewater and solidify sludge, meaning that it is impossible to continuously dewater the sludge or discharge the dewatered and solidified sludge in a timely manner, which affects the efficiency of sludge dewatering and solidification treatment. Meanwhile, existing technologies lack a structure that can add sludge in a timely manner, meaning that sludge cannot be added continuously for dewatering, and it is difficult to control the amount of sludge added, which affects the sludge treatment effect.

[0026] Existing technologies lack structures capable of continuous dewatering and solidification, meaning they cannot continuously dewater sludge or promptly discharge the dewatered and solidified sludge, thus affecting the efficiency of sludge dewatering and solidification treatment. To address this issue, the following technical solution is proposed: Refer to the instruction manual appendix Figures 1-7 A sludge dewatering and solidification treatment device and method, such as Figure 1 and Figure 2 As shown, the device includes a dewatering tank 1, a drainage trough 2 connected to the bottom of the dewatering tank 1, a filter plate trough 3 fixedly installed on the top of the drainage trough 2, a pressure filter and discharge mechanism 4 inside the dewatering tank 1, and a feeding mechanism 5 on the top of the dewatering tank 1. The pressure filter and discharge mechanism 4 can reciprocate to squeeze the sludge at the bottom for dewatering and solidification treatment, and push out the dewatered sludge in time. The feeding mechanism 5 can send in new sludge with water after the dewatered sludge is discharged, so as to continuously carry out sludge dewatering and solidification treatment.
[0027] like Figure 1 and Figure 3As shown, the filter press and discharge mechanism 4 includes a motor 41 fixedly installed on the outer wall of the dewatering tank 1. A rotating roller 42 is fixedly installed at the output end of the motor 41. The rotating roller 42 is set in a horizontal state. A filter press cylinder 43 is fixedly installed on the outer wall of the rotating roller 42. The filter press cylinder 43 is eccentrically mounted inside the dewatering tank 1. The filter press cylinder 43 is set in a cam shape. The outer wall of the filter press cylinder 43 and the inner wall of the dewatering tank 1 are mutually matched. The motor 41 starts and drives the rotating roller 42 to rotate the filter press cylinder 43. The filter press cylinder 43 approaches and squeezes the sludge through its raised side, so that the water in the sludge is discharged from the filter plate groove 3.
[0028] like Figure 3 and Figure 4 As shown, a scraper 44 is fixedly installed on one side of the outer wall of the filter press cylinder 43. The scraper 44 is set in a vertical position. The outer wall of the scraper 44 is in contact with the inner wall of the dewatering tank 1. A pushing strip 45 is fixedly installed on one side of the scraper 44. The pushing strip 45 is set in a comb shape and an arc shape. The outer wall of the pushing strip 45 is in contact with the inner wall of the dewatering tank 1. The rotation of the filter press cylinder 43 drives the scraper 44 to move the squeezed sludge forward.
[0029] like Figure 4 and Figure 5 As shown, a discharge box 46 is connected to the bottom of one side of the dehydration tank 1. The top of the discharge box 46 is inclined downward. A cover plate 47 is rotatably installed on the top of the discharge box 46. The outer wall of the cover plate 47 is in contact with the inner wall of the top of the discharge box 46. Multiple support springs 48 are fixedly installed at the bottom of the cover plate 47. Multiple support springs 48 are fixedly installed on the inner wall of the discharge box 46. A pressure plate 49 is fixedly installed on the top of the cover plate 47. The pressure plate 49 is set in a vertical state. The top of the pressure plate 49 is set in an inclined state. The pushing strips 45 driven by the rotation of the filter press cylinder 43 approach and squeeze the pressing plate 49 before the scraper 44, which in turn causes the pressing plate 49 to press down, causing the cover plate 47 to deflect downward and compress multiple support springs 48, thereby opening the discharge box 46 to facilitate the discharge of dewatered sludge.
[0030] like Figure 4 and Figure 5As shown, a blocking plate 410 is slidably installed on one side of the cover plate 47. A slot is opened on the inner wall of the discharge box 46. The slot and the blocking plate 410 are mutually matched. Multiple locking springs 411 are fixedly installed on the outer wall of one side of the blocking plate 410. Multiple locking springs 411 are fixedly installed on the inner wall of the cover plate 47. A push strip 412 is fixedly installed on the top of the blocking plate 410. The push strip 412 and the blocking plate 410 are mutually perpendicular. A sealing plate 413 is fixedly installed on the outer wall of the push strip 412. The bottom of the sealing plate 413 is in contact with the top of the cover plate 47. The width of the sealing plate 413 is greater than the width of the push strip 412. The sealing plate 413 can seal the area of the push strip 412's movement space to prevent sludge from directly entering the discharge box 46. The driven pushing strip 45 presses the pushing strip 412 before the pressing plate 49. The pushing strip 412 drives the locking plate 410 to move backward, unlocking the locking plate 410 and compressing multiple locking springs 411, so that the locking plate 410 can rotate.
[0031] In practical implementation, the motor 41 starts and drives the rotating roller 42 to rotate the filter press cylinder 43. The filter press cylinder 43 approaches and squeezes the sludge through its raised side, so that the water in the sludge is discharged from the filter plate groove 3. The rotation of the filter press cylinder 43 drives the scraper 44 to move the squeezed sludge forward. The driven pushing strip 45 squeezes the pushing strip 412 before the pressing plate 49. The pushing strip 412 drives the blocking plate 410 to move backward, unlocking the blocking plate 410 and compressing multiple locking springs 411, so that the blocking plate 410 can rotate. The pushing strip 45 driven by the rotation of the filter press cylinder 43 approaches and squeezes the pressing plate 49 before the scraper 44, so that the pressing plate 49 presses down, causing the cover plate 47 to deflect downward and compress multiple support springs 48, thereby opening the discharge box 46, which facilitates the discharge of the dewatered sludge, achieving the effect of continuous dewatering and discharge of sludge, and avoiding affecting the efficiency of sludge dewatering and solidification treatment. Example 2
[0032] Existing technologies lack a structure that allows for the timely addition of sludge, meaning that sludge cannot be continuously added for dewatering, and the amount of sludge added is difficult to control, affecting the sludge treatment effect. To solve this problem, the following technical solution is proposed: like Figure 6 and Figure 7 As shown, the feeding mechanism 5 includes a feeding box 51 connected to one side of the top of the dehydration box 1. A baffle plate 52 is provided on one side of the feeding box 51. The baffle plate 52 is slidably installed on the inner wall of the dehydration box 1. The baffle plate 52 is set in a vertical state and is tangent to the inner wall of the dehydration box 1. The feed box 51 can carry the sludge with water into the dewatering box 1, while the baffle plate 52 can block the sludge from entering the feed box 51.
[0033] like Figure 6 and Figure 7 As shown, a lifting block 53 is fixedly installed on the bottom outer wall of the material blocking plate 52. The lifting block 53 and the material blocking plate 52 are arranged perpendicular to each other. A pressure spring 54 is fixedly installed on the top of the material blocking plate 52. The pressure spring 54 is fixedly installed on the inner wall of the dehydration tank 1 and fits against each other. As the filter press cylinder 43 continues to rotate, the pushing strip 45 moves closer to and presses against the lifting block 53, which in turn causes the lifting block 53 to move the material blocking plate 52 upward and open, thus the material blocking plate 52 compresses the pressure spring 54.
[0034] like Figure 6 and Figure 7 As shown, a plurality of pressing rods 55 are fixedly installed on the top of the material blocking plate 52. The plurality of pressing rods 55 penetrate the outer wall of the dewatering tank 1. A first toothed plate 56 is fixedly installed on the top of the plurality of pressing rods 55. A gear 57 is meshed on one side of the first toothed plate 56. The gear 57 is rotatably installed on the outer wall of the dewatering tank 1. A second toothed plate 58 is meshed on the other side of the gear 57. The second toothed plate 58 is slidably installed on the inner wall of the dewatering tank 1. The second toothed plate 58 penetrates the inner wall of the dewatering tank 1. The bottom of the second toothed plate 58 is inclined upward. After the material blocking plate 52 moves upward, it drives multiple pressing rods 55 to move upward synchronously. The multiple pressing rods 55 drive the first toothed plate 56, causing the gear 57 to push the second toothed plate 58 downward and extend out of the inner wall of the dewatering box 1. Then, after the filter press cylinder 43 continues to rotate and drives the pushing strip 45 to pass over the material blocking plate 52, the pushing strip 45 then approaches the bottom of the pushing second toothed plate 58, thereby causing the second toothed plate 58 to push the material blocking plate 52 downward in the opposite direction and close the feed box 51.
[0035] In practice, as the filter press cylinder 43 continues to rotate, the pushing strips 45 move closer to and press against the lifting block 53, causing the lifting block 53 to move the material blocking plate 52 upward and open. The material blocking plate 52 then compresses the pressure spring 54. After the material blocking plate 52 moves upward, it drives multiple pressing rods 55 to move upward simultaneously. The multiple pressing rods 55 drive the first toothed plate 56, causing the gear 57 to push the second toothed plate 58 downward and extend it out of the inner wall of the dewatering box 1. After the pushing strips 45, driven by the continued rotation of the filter press cylinder 43, pass over the material blocking plate 52, the pushing strips 45 move closer to and push the bottom of the second toothed plate 58, causing the second toothed plate 58 to push the material blocking plate 52 downward and close the feed box 51. This allows for continuous addition of sludge for dewatering while controlling the amount of sludge added.
